Catalaiya's pov:
This morning, I woke up to a loud thud coming from the room. My eyes snapped opened and I turned around to look at the source.
"I'm so sorry I woke you up." Thalia apologised as she pick up whatever she dropped on the floor.
"It's okay," I reassured her. My eyes landed on the bag she was holding and I recognised it, it was one of my bags.
"My stuff is here?" I asked her and she nodded.
"Your brother dropped them off this morning and I already put everything in the closet, as Aziel asked me to." She replied before disappearing into the closet.
Speaking of him...
I shifted my gaze on the empty space beside me and the bed look untouched. I didn't see Aziel since he left me at the door. Did he even slept here?
Thalia walked out of the closet.
"Where is he?" I asked Thalia. She instantly understood who I was referring to.
"He's still at work, he didn't come home yet." She replied.
Oh
"How about you freshen up and I'll serve breakfast." She suggested and I nodded. Since I didn't have any clothes with me yesterday, I ended up sleeping in the pink dress she gave me. I couldn't even shower.
I sat down on the bed and reach to grab my phone from the bed table. I turn it on and my eyes widened when I looked at the clock. It was 9:15 am, I overslept.
There were a few emails from the office and a few miss calls from my assistant, Nayve.
I'll have to call her soon...
I pulled the blanket off me and I stood up. I put my phone back on the bed table before walking to the bathroom.

I did my business, brushed my teeth and washed my face. I then hop in the shower. The warm water hit my skin, making me sigh contented. I stayed for 15 minutes before I stepped out, dried myself and wrapped a towel around my breast.
I walked to the big closet and found my clothes.

I did a light make up, brushed my hair and then made my way downstairs. I found Thalia in the kitchen, flipping some pancakes.
"So how did you sleep?" She asked as I stood by the counter.
"It was surprisingly good, I overslept which rarely happens to me." I replied making her chuckle.
"That's great," she commented.
She made a few more pancakes, cook some sausages and went near the fridge to get some juices.
"By the way, Aziel called again and he will be joining you for breakfast," Thalia informed me.
That should be interesting.
"When will he be here?"
As soon as those words left my mouth, we heard the door open. We turned to look toward the door and Aziel walked in while loosening his tie.
"Serve breakfast, Thalia." He told Thalia, briefly glancing at me. He might sound demanding and a jerk but the tone he used on her, show me that he respected her.
It also seemed like he doesn't even want to look at me.
"You don't want to freshen up first?" Thalia asked and he shook his head no.
"I'll freshen up after breakfast. I need to go back to work right after." Aziel replied.

He sat at the dining table, putting his phone on the table. He was sitting at the head of the table and I presume that's his usual spot.
"Take a seat beside him," Thalia murmured beside me.

I hesitantly nodded before making my way to the table. I sat on the right side and he moved his blank stare on me. Thalia stood in between us with the breakfast and serve us. Aziel instantly dig in and i started to eat too.
He abruptly stopped eating as if he remembered something and reached to take out something in his pocket. I watched as he removed one of his credit cards and slap it on the table in front of me, startling me.
"I should have given it to you yesterday before leaving, but I forgot." He said dryly, his cold eyes boring into my dull hazel eyes. I kept the stare for a few seconds and it was enough for me to understand that this man hates me.
He thinks I want his credit card? His money?
I didn't expect him to like me or befriend me but neither did I expect that he would have so much hate for me.
I was just a burden for him.
Little does he knows that I'm stuck here too...
I dropped my fork lightly on the table, suddenly losing my appetite.
"Thalia, tell Alfred that he will be madam's driver from now on," Aziel told Thalia, who nodded silently.
Aziel stood up, grabbed his phone before making his way upstairs. I felt a hand on my shoulder and I looked at Thalia who was looking at me with a sympathetic smile.
"I'm not hungry, I'll be in the library." I excused myself as I stood up. I walked to the library room and closed the door behind me.
I knew this wasn't going to be easy. I had mentally prepared myself for the worst before the deal but it still hit hard. I don't like this feeling of being a burden on someone. If it wasn't for this stupid contract, Aziel would be free, burdenless... he wouldn't even know me.
I sat down on the ground, crossed my legs before closing my eyes. I took a deep breath in and let everything out. I did this for a few minutes before I stopped and opened my eyes.
Catalaiya, you are strong. You can do this. Everytime you fell, you pulled yourself up and showed people that you didn't give a damn care... this one might be tougher but you are stronger.
I inwardly encouraged myself.
I stayed on the ground, my eyes looking outside through the window. The leaves sway as the wind blow. I took in the silent atmosphere and the peacefulness that this room offered.
It didn't last long.
I felt my phone vibrate and I looked down. It was a message from Nayve.
